The SoftPro Wearable System for Grasp Compensation in Stroke Patients
2020
This extended abstract presents a wearable system for assistance that is a combination of different technologies including sensing, haptics, orthotics and robotics. The result is a device that, by compensating for force deficiencies, helps lifting the forearm and thanks to a robotic supernumerary finger improves the grasping ability of an impaired hand. A pilot study involving three post-stroke patients was conducted to test the effectiveness of the device to assist in performing activities of daily living (ADLs), confirming its usefulness.
